Although Longport Train Station is relatively quaint, it is equipped with essential amenities designed to support your journey. Tickets can't be purchased at a ticket office here, but there are machines available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. Unfortunately, there are no accessible ticket machines. Smartcard validators are present, allowing for modern and seamless travel experiences. CCTV cameras are in operation, enhancing your security while at the station.
Getting assistance is simple at Longport. Although there is no dedicated staff help available on-site, helpful points are scattered throughout the station grounds to cater to your informational needs. Those requiring assistance due to mobility impairments should note that although step-free access is available in parts of the station, the ramps can be challenging, particularly on Platform 1, which lacks lowered kerbs.
For those wondering about onward travel, the rail replacement service is conveniently located at the station entrance. Although live public bus updates are not directly available, planning your bus journey from Longport can easily be done by accessing the printable information provided here. The station is well-equipped with facilities to make your journey hassle-free. Purchasing tickets is simple with the presence of an accessible ticket office opening from early in the morning till late at night, along with multiple ticket machines available at key locations across the station. For those who prefer smart technology, smartcards are issued and validated here, offering a seamless travel experience. There is no shortage of seating areas within the station although you won't find a first-class lounge or a traditional waiting room. Accessibility is handled with thoughtful consideration, ensuring ease of movement for all passengers.
Blackheath station boasts partial step-free access, with platform 1 featuring a lift for services heading towards London, and platform 2 accessible via a ramp for services departing from London. An induction loop and accessible ticket machines help ensure that those with hearing and mobility needs are catered for. A meeting point is conveniently located at the ticket office or you may opt to use the help point for assistance. While luggage storage is absent, the station does ensure safety and security with CCTV surveillance.
Grabbing a quick bite or a hot drink is effortless with a coffee kiosk and vending machines right at the station. An ATM is also present near the ticket office for any last-minute cash withdrawals. However, those in need of currency exchange services will need to seek these elsewhere as they are not available at the station. If you plan on cycling to or from Blackheath, you will find ample bicycle storage on Platforms 1 and 2, complete with shelters, albeit without CCTV protection.
Finding your way beyond the train station is facilitated by various transport links. The station is well-served by local bus services, with stops conveniently positioned near the Railway Tavern. Taxis are also readily available, making it easy to get mobile for those trips not covered by rail. In the unfortunate event of service disruptions, a rail replacement service to Charlton or Kidbrooke is accessible from Route 89 bus stop D, with services towards Lewisham from bus stop E.
